Fix incorrect return value in brin_minmax_multi_distance_numeric().
The result of "DirectFunctionCall1(numeric_float8, d)" is already in
Datum form, but the code was incorrectly applying PG_RETURN_FLOAT8()
to it. On machines where float8 is pass-by-reference, this would
result in complete garbage, since an unpredictable pointer value
would be treated as an integer and then converted to float. It's not
entirely clear how much of a problem would ensue on 64-bit hardware,
but certainly interpreting a float8 bitpattern as uint64 and then
converting that to float isn't the intended behavior.
As luck would have it, even the complete-garbage case doesn't break
BRIN indexes, since the results are only used to make choices about
how to merge values into ranges: at worst, we'd make poor choices
resulting in an inefficient index. Doubtless that explains the lack
of field complaints. However, users with BRIN indexes that use the
numeric_minmax_multi_ops opclass may wish to reindex in hopes of
making their indexes more efficient.
